Singapore Sling

The Singapore Sling is a vibrant and fruity cocktail that originated in the early 20th century at the Raffles Hotel in Singapore. This refreshing drink typically combines gin, cherry brandy, and a mix of tropical juices, often garnished with a slice of pineapple or a cherry, creating a delightful balance of sweet and tart flavors. Its iconic pink hue and complex taste make it a popular choice for those seeking a taste of Southeast Asian flair.

Ingredients

  • 1/2 ozCherry brandy
  • 1/2 ozGrenadine
  • 1 ozGin
  • 2 ozSweet and sour
  • Carbonated water
  • Cherry

Preparation

  1. 1

    Pour all ingredients into cocktail shaker filled with ice cubes. Shake well. Strain into highball glass. Garnish with pineapple and cocktail cherry.

History & Origins

The Singapore Sling is a legendary tropical cocktail created in 1915 at the Raffles Hotel in Singapore, embodying colonial era elegance and the romance of exotic Asian hospitality. This complex, aromatic drink represents the pinnacle of tropical cocktail craftsmanship and the intersection of Eastern and Western cocktail traditions. The Singapore Sling remains an icon of luxury travel and sophisticated drinking culture worldwide.
